Framework definitions

Wordset Dictionary5 sensesview framework →
§1
a somewhat flat reddish-orange loose skinned citrus of China
§2
a high public official of imperial China
§3
any high government official or bureaucrat
§4
a member of an elite intellectual or cultural group
§5
shrub or small tree having flattened globose fruit with very sweet aromatic pulp and thin yellow-orange to flame-orange rind that is loose and easily removed
